# Tide-table widget (Shorewind embed). Pulls predictions from the
# Nettlecove almanac feed, cached 6h. Offsets are per-harbor; see the
# harbors map. Review note: do not change the interpolation step —
# downstream charts assume 10-minute granularity. Prediction rows are
# stored in the database named just below.

replica DSN, yahaf-yagaf: mongodb://tamath_svc:a2netSk3RZMuTj@db-d084.novacsoft.internal:5432/ralmir

**Q: The intern cohort arrives Monday — how do they get in?**

Interns for the Larkfield intake report to the east lobby at 09:00. Temporary lanyards are pre-printed; permanent badges issue by day three. Escort them as a group through turnstile C. Do not let interns tailgate through staff doors. For the orientation room on Level 1, the keypad code is below.

door code, kawip-bagap: bdg-HQEWH-4

# Why these constants exist:
# The Ledgerly integration suite flakes when the sandbox gateway at
# Torvik lags under load. Retries with backoff fixed most of it; the
# rest is timeout tuning. Support: if a customer reports stuck test
# payments, check these values before escalating — they bound every
# retry loop in this module. Do not change without a load test.
# The current tuning constants are listed below.

limits module of yadug-tawip:
QUOTAS = {
    "julael": 705,
    "kasael": 903,
    "druwyn": 489,
}